Ingredients for Soft Christmas Peppermints Recipe – Festive Christmas Homemade Candy
- 3 cups powdered sugar, plus more for dusting
- 2 tablespoons unsalted butter, softened
- 2 tablespoons cream cheese, softened
- 2 tablespoons heavy cream
- 1 teaspoon pure peppermint extract
- Red and green food coloring
- Pinch of salt
Instructions for Making Soft Christmas Peppermints Recipe – Festive Christmas Homemade Candy
- In a large mixing bowl, combine the softened butter, cream cheese, and a pinch of salt. Beat until smooth and creamy using a hand mixer or stand mixer.
- Add the heavy cream and peppermint extract. Beat again until the mixture is well-blended and fluffy.
- Gradually add the powdered sugar, a cup at a time, mixing after each addition. The mixture will become thick and eventually form a soft dough.
- Lightly dust your work surface with powdered sugar. Divide the dough into three equal portions.
- Leave one portion white. Add a few drops of red food coloring to the second portion and knead until evenly colored. Repeat with green food coloring for the third portion.
- Pinch off small pieces (about 1 teaspoon each) and roll between your palms to form smooth balls or oval shapes. For a traditional mint appearance, use a fork to gently flatten and imprint each candy.
- Arrange the peppermints on a parchment-lined tray. Let them air-dry at room temperature for about 4-6 hours, or until the outsides are set but the centers remain soft.
- Store the finished candy in an airtight container with parchment paper between layers. Keep in a cool, dry place for up to 2 weeks.

Cooking Tips and Variations
Making the perfect Soft Christmas Peppermints Recipe – Festive Christmas Homemade Candy is all about technique and personalization. Ensure that your butter and cream cheese are fully softened before blending to achieve a smooth, lump-free dough.
Gradually add powdered sugar to prevent the mixture from becoming too stiff; you want a dough that is pliable but not sticky. If the dough does become too stiff, a few drops of heavy cream can loosen it up.
Kneading in color can be a fun family activity, and you can even divide the dough into smaller portions for a rainbow assortment. For an added festive touch, toss the finished candies in sanding sugar for sparkle or press the tops with a holiday-themed mold or stamp.
If you prefer a dairy-free version, substitute the butter and cream cheese with plant-based alternatives and adjust the cream as needed for consistency. To further enhance the flavor, experiment with extracts like vanilla or almond, but always keep the peppermint profile dominant for that classic holiday feel.
Storing the candies in wax paper or cellophane wrap adds a charming touch for holiday gifting and helps maintain freshness.

FAQs About Soft Christmas Peppermints Recipe – Festive Christmas Homemade Candy
Can I make Soft Christmas Peppermints Recipe – Festive Christmas Homemade Candy ahead of time?
Yes, these homemade mints can be prepared up to two weeks in advance. Store them in an airtight container with parchment between layers and keep in a cool, dry place. They retain their softness for several days and can even be frozen for longer storage.
Can I use natural food coloring in this Soft Christmas Peppermints Recipe – Festive Christmas Homemade Candy?
Absolutely! Natural food colorings such as beet juice for red or spirulina for green can be used for a more wholesome version. Simply mix in small amounts until desired color is achieved.
How can I make these mints dairy-free?
For a dairy-free option, substitute plant-based butter and cream cheese alternatives, and use a non-dairy milk or coconut cream for the heavy cream. The result will be slightly different in texture but still delicious.
What is the best way to gift Soft Christmas Peppermints Recipe – Festive Christmas Homemade Candy?
Place individual mints in festive cellophane bags, mini tins, or small jars, and tie with holiday ribbon. Add a personalized tag for a thoughtful, homemade present.
Can I use other extracts besides peppermint?
Yes, you can try flavors like vanilla, almond, or lemon for variation, but peppermint remains the traditional and most popular choice for Christmas mints.

Ingredients
- 4 cups powdered sugar, plus extra for dusting
- 4 oz cream cheese, softened
- 2 tablespoons unsalted butter, softened
- 1/2 teaspoon pure peppermint extract
- Red and green food coloring (gel preferred)
- 1/4 teaspoon vanilla extract
- Pinch of salt
- Sprinkles or colored sugar for decoration (optional)
Instructions
-
1In a large mixing bowl, beat together the softened cream cheese and unsalted butter until smooth and creamy.
-
2Add peppermint extract, vanilla extract, and a pinch of salt; mix until incorporated.
-
3Gradually add the powdered sugar, one cup at a time, mixing well after each addition. The mixture should be thick but pliable like a dough.
-
4Divide the dough into three portions. Leave one plain, then tint one with red food coloring and one with green food coloring. Knead in color until evenly distributed.
-
5Roll out small portions of dough into balls (about 1 teaspoon each) and gently flatten. Arrange on a parchment-lined baking sheet. Decorate with sprinkles or colored sugar if desired.
-
6Let the peppermints air dry at room temperature for at least 4 hours or until set. Store in an airtight container.
